China Zhejiang Hangzhou Alibaba Cloud
Websites on 47.97.69.150
- Domain names that have been bound:
- 2022-05-11-----2024-08-15086315.net
- 2022-03-11-----2024-07-2586-315.cn
- 2022-06-07-----2024-05-05atfw.86-315.cn
- 2022-03-06-----2024-04-18www.86-315.cn
- 2022-05-19-----2024-03-2086-315.net
- 2023-09-18-----2023-11-07www.086315.net
- 2022-03-11-----2023-05-1586-315.com
- website server lookup history
- aa45.vip
- 711kkk.com
- supplierhub.accenture.com
- xn01.adslip.cc
- n1a.akamaiedge.net
- v11av2686.cc
- 0724yx.com
- 18c.jmcomic2.com
- www.927game.com
- 28366k.com
- paidy.com
- www490011.com
- gxhydk.com
- www.19997.net
- youxishen.com
- 2888880.com
- zxkagdec.szd81.com
- sf1992.com
- 99897.com
- ahsvsm.com
- hosting ip address lookup history
- 20.2.144.210
- 222.22.0.2
- 47.52.203.147
- 111.55.210.245
- 18.65.185.81
- 39.98.38.219
- 120.25.239.34
- 104.21.63.166
- 46.8.121.33
- 23.230.186.156
- 172.252.29.48
- 147.161.32.74
- 18.183.189.150
- 89.116.247.240
- 120.232.251.184
- 45.197.57.237
- 154.93.189.147
- 154.202.53.211
- 154.193.236.251
- 52.92.1.4
